Did Tyler Cheat?

So the big question is.."Did Tyler cheat?" The facts are clearly stated in today's Velonews post.

"Hamilton is facing up to a two-year ban after a backup test taken at the Vuelta a EspaƱa confirmed an initial positive test that showed evidence of banned blood transfusions. Hamilton was allowed to keep his Olympic time trial gold medal despite failing an 'A' sample after testers inadvertently placed second 'B' blood samples in a deep freeze, rendering red blood cells unusable for follow-up tests.

Hamilton has vehemently denied he injected someone else's blood into his system and has promised to challenge the validity of the testing method to prove his innocence."


Unless there is foul play or a faulty test, as much as I don't want to, I have to rely on the facts as we know them. His reputation says that he didn't do it, I don't want to believe it and I hope he can clear his name. But for now, I think he did it.
